Variety is reporting that Daniel Battsek is stepping down as president of Miramax. His departure follows the recent announcement that Disney (which owns Miramax) would be significantly downsizing the specialty division. Variety quoted Walt Disney Studios chairman Rich Ross saying in a statement, “With the change in direction at Miramax, we appreciate Daniel’s desire to leave the organization. During his 18 years of service, he has brought some very prestigious and award-winning films to the studio, from Calendar Girls to The Queen to No Country for Old Men. We wish Daniel the very best on his future endeavors.”
